The submitter has given permission to the USGenWeb Archives to store the file permanently for free access. ==================================================================== Surnames: Lowry, Blaylock, Mullins Originally posted at: http://boards.ancestry.com/mbexec/msg/rw/5YB.2ACE/5265 Funeral services were held for Agnes Lowry on October 14, 2002, at the Martin Funeral Home Chapel with interment at Red Hill Cemetery, Hammon, Roger Mills County, Oklahoma. Agnes Fay was born October 1, 1928 on a farm north of Hammon to Mac and Sally Blaylock Mullins and died at the age of 74. She attended Hammon School and while in school married Wayne Lowry in Wheeler, Texas on September 28, 1946. They began farming on a farm north of Hammon and in the surrounding areas. Agnes began her nursing career aand became a LPN in 1975. She worked as a nurse for 18 years. She was a member of the Hammon Baptist Church. In 1986, the Lowry's moved to their present home northeast of Canute. Agnes is survived by her husband, Wayne, four sons, one brother, three sisters, eight grandchildren, five great grandchildren, and a host of other relatives and friends. Cheyenne Star, Cheyenne, OK 17-Oct-2002 --------------------------------------------------------------------
